Stella (ALPHA) coin is too volatile, is it a safe investment?

Be mindful of the volatile nature of Stella (ALPHA) coin, as its price can swing significantly due to market sentiment, news events, and supply and demand dynamics.

Dec 24, 2024 at 08:17 am

Key Points:

  • Understand the volatility of Stella (ALPHA) coin.
  • Assess the factors influencing Stella (ALPHA) coin's price.
  • Evaluate the risks associated with investing in Stella (ALPHA) coin.

Step 1: Understanding Volatility in Cryptocurrency

The cryptocurrency market is renowned for its volatility, with prices experiencing large fluctuations in value within short periods. Alpha Coin (ALPHA) is no exception, and its price can exhibit significant swings. This volatility can be attributed to various factors, including:

  • Market sentiment: Positive or negative sentiment within the cryptocurrency community can drive price movements.
  • News events: Announcements, regulations, and industry news can have a significant impact on the price of Alpha Coin.
  • Supply and demand: Changes in the supply and demand of Alpha Coin can affect its price.

Step 2: Factors Influencing Stella (ALPHA) Coin's Price

Several factors play a role in determining the price of Stella (ALPHA) coin. These include:

  • Project roadmap: The development team's plans and milestones can influence investor confidence and, subsequently, the price of the coin.
  • Adoption: Wider adoption of Alpha Coin for transactions or use within dApps can drive demand and increase its value.
  • Competition: Alpha Coin faces competition from similar projects and established cryptocurrencies, affecting its market share and price.

Step 3: Assessing Investment Risks

Investing in Alpha Coin involves several risks that should be carefully considered:

  • Volatility: The significant price fluctuations can lead to substantial losses or gains, depending on the market conditions.
  • Regulatory uncertainty: Cryptocurrency regulations are constantly evolving, and changes in regulations could impact the value of Alpha Coin.
  • Market manipulation: The cryptocurrency market is susceptible to manipulation by large holders or trading bots, which could affect Alpha Coin's price.

Step 4: Mitigating Investment Risks

Despite the risks associated with investing in Alpha Coin, there are steps you can take to mitigate them:

  • Diversification: Avoid investing heavily in a single cryptocurrency like Alpha Coin. Spread your investments across multiple assets to manage risk.
  • Dollar-cost averaging: Make regular purchases of Alpha Coin instead of investing lump sums. This helps average out your purchase price and reduce the impact of volatility.
  • Set stop-loss orders: Place orders to automatically sell Alpha Coin when it reaches a predetermined price level to limit potential losses.
